Hajdúszoboszló Spa

Hajdúszoboszló is located in the north- eastern part of the Great Hungarian Plain, 200 kilometres east of Budapest, and 20 kilometres south-west of Debrecen. Three regions meet one another at our town's boundary: the Hajdúhát ridge from the north-north-east, Hortobágy from the north-north-west, and the Great Sárrét and Berettyó region from the south. This is a landscape "where the earth and the skies meet," it is not a monotonous plain, not even for travellers accustomed to romantic mountains, sine here and there the landscape is enlivened by the backwaters of the Tisza river with patches of reed, thousands of wild fowl, and inviting groves. The surroundings are the renowned puszta, the "glorious plain". Szoboszló lies at a height of scarcely 100-110 metres above sea level and slopes down a little towards Hortobágy. We even have a "river" of our own, a stream winding through the town,

the Kösely, which according to a native of the town, Endre Hőgyes (1847-1906), the famous physician and scientist, is as characteristic of this place, as is the Danube of our capital city.

A 12-14 km reach of the Eastern Main Canal runs along the boundary of the town in north-south direction. This canal does not only serve the purpose of irrigation, but is also a splendid place of relaxation for the locals and their guests wishing to go in for swimming, boating, fishing or gardening in natural surroundings. One of the natural values of the region, besides the fertile agricultural areas, the gas fields and the medicinal water, is the abundance of sunshine. The number of hours of sunshine reaches, or sometimes even exceeds, two thousand hours on an annual average. That is to say, Hajdúszoboszló is one of the sunniest regions in Hungary. The prevailing wind direction is north-western. On the one hand, the micro-climate of the medicinal baths and the surroundings, with the iodine content and salty humidity of the air, speeds up recuperation, on the other hand, the visitors here always have a good chance to enjoy fine weather, for to be sure, the number of winter days is merely 30-40, with an average temperature of 0 °C, and the number of summer days with an average temperature of 25 °C is 80-85.

Accessibility to the spa is ideal. It is easy by rail because the town can be found on the Budapest-Debrecen-Nyíregyháza-Záhony main line. Every fast train, six Inter-City expresses, and also two international trains stop here. In summer there is direct connection to Lake Balaton. The timetable for railway line No. 100 gives precise information on possibilities of access. The highway No. 4 between Budapest and Záhony, which runs through the town, interconnects many other smaller and bigger routes, ensuring good travelling conditions for those coming here by car or in other vehicles. The modern motorway No. 3 can similarly be reached quickly from here, for example in the direction of Hortobágy-Tiszafüred-Füzesabony. The long-distance bus services connect the various regions of the country with this town of "miraculous springs". Once again there is the opportunity to approach Szoboszló by air, as well, thanks to Debrecen Airport.

Local transport from the railway station to the town centre and the holiday district, is provided for by regular bus services and taxies from early morning until late at night.

The excellent medicinal effect of the thermal water is due to its components (ionide, bromide, common salt, hydrogen-carbonate, bitumen and the adhering oestrogen, trace elements present in form of titanium, copper, zinc, silver, barium, vanadium and lead, etc.).

When used with proper expertise, this "medicine chest" of nature, can be a remedy for numerous illnesses, or can ease suffering and ailments. The pools filled with water of various temperatures, combined with balneotherapy and physiotherapy, can heal partially or completely the foolowing diseases: disorders of surgical, neurological, internal and dermal origin, and further, locomotor dieseases, parpoplexy and conditions after orthopedic operations, paralysis, chronic neurotic pains, leg ulcers, gynaecological inflammations, infertility, prostrate gland problems, eczema, psoriasis, scoliosis, various sclerosis problems, etc. ... etc.
